What is the Orthodontic Bands Market Size and Growth Rate?

  • As per Data Bridge Market Research analysis, the orthodontic bands market was valued at USD 3.30 billion in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 6.06 bill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 7.90% from 2026 to 2033.
  • The market is experiencing consistent growth driven by the rising prevalence of malocclusion, increasing demand for orthodontic treatments, growing awareness of oral health, and expanding access to dental care and orthodontic procedures globally.
  • The increasing demand for effective and durable orthodontic appliances, combined with rising dental tourism and favorable reimbursement for dental procedures, is encouraging orthodontic clinics and hospitals to adopt orthodontic bands. Advancements in orthodontic materials and designs are further supporting their use in complex tooth alignment and bite-correction procedures.

What is the Key Trend in the Orthodontic Bands Market?

  • Orthodontic manufacturers are increasingly developing anatomically contoured and precision-fit bands that improve tooth adaptation, retention, positioning accuracy, and patient comfort during fixed orthodontic treatment.
  • For instance, in June 2025, a study published in the European Journal of Orthodontics evaluated 3D-printed orthodontic metallic bands made from stainless steel and cobalt-chromium alloys, highlighting the development of digitally manufactured, patient-specific orthodontic band technologies.
  • Manufacturers are also expanding band portfolios across first molars, second molars, and bicuspids while offering multiple sizes and retention configurations to accommodate different tooth anatomies and treatment requirements.
  • Digital orthodontic workflows are increasingly influencing fixed-appliance treatment, with clinicians using intraoral scanning and digital treatment planning to improve customization, appliance fit, and overall treatment efficiency.
  • For instance, in May 2026, a clinical study published in Medicina evaluated CAD/CAM-customized orthodontic molar bands in 180 adolescents and found significantly lower plaque accumulation, gingival bleeding, and probing depth than conventional stainless-steel bands, supporting digitally customized band designs
  • As orthodontic manufacturers continue prioritizing precision fit, anatomical customization, and integration with digitally enabled treatment workflows, the adoption of advanced orthodontic bands is expected to increase, reinforcing customized band design as an important direction in fixed orthodontic treatment.

What are the Key Drivers of the Orthodontic Bands Market?

  • The rising prevalence of malocclusion and orthodontic treatment needs is significantly increasing demand for fixed orthodontic appliances, including molar bands used for anchorage, archwire support, and complex bite correction.
  • For instance, in February 2025, a study published in Scientific Reports assessed children aged 10–12 years and found Class I malocclusion in 53.3% of participants, with Class II Division 2 at 20.8% and Class II Division 1 at 15.8%, demonstrating the substantial prevalence of orthodontic conditions that can drive demand for fixed orthodontic appliances.
  • Increasing availability of orthodontic treatment among children and adolescents, together with growing awareness of dental aesthetics and oral health, is encouraging orthodontists to use durable anchorage components in comprehensive fixed-appliance treatments.
  • For instance, in November 2024, a study published in BMC Oral Health examining schoolchildren in Shanghai found that malocclusion affected oral health-related quality of life, with more severe malocclusion producing greater oral-health impacts, supporting the need for orthodontic evaluation and treatment among affected children
  • With orthodontic practices increasingly seeking reliable retention, anatomically accurate fitting, and treatment-specific appliance components, orthodontic bands will remain important in fixed orthodontic procedures, supporting continued demand for molar and bicuspid band systems.

Which Factors are Challenging the Growth of the Orthodontic Bands Market?

  • Orthodontic bands made from metal alloys can create concerns regarding nickel exposure and hypersensitivity, particularly among patients with existing metal allergies, encouraging clinicians to consider alternative materials or low-nickel products.
  • For instance, in July 2024, a study published in the Journal of Functional Biomaterials reported that hypersensitivity reactions in orthodontic patients can result from the release of metal ions, particularly nickel, from orthodontic appliances, causing oral lesions, discomfort, and pain and potentially affecting treatment outcomes.
  • These material-related concerns can complicate product selection and increase the need for allergy screening and biocompatibility considerations, potentially limiting the use of conventional stainless-steel bands in sensitive patient groups.
  • For instance, in May 2025, a study published in Dentistry Journal examined nickel-ion release from nickel-containing orthodontic appliances and highlighted the potential for prolonged exposure to contribute to nickel hypersensitivity, reinforcing concerns over the biocompatibility of conventional metal orthodontic components.
  • The concerns surrounding metal hypersensitivity, material biocompatibility, and patient-specific appliance selection continue to challenge the widespread use of conventional orthodontic bands, particularly where clinicians must accommodate patients with known nickel sensitivity or other material-related allergies.

How is the Orthodontic Bands Market Segmented?

The orthodontic bands market is segmented on the basis of product type, material, design, and application.

  • By Product Type

On the basis of product type, the orthodontic bands market is segmented into molar bands and premolar bands. The molar bands segment dominated the market with a share of 70% in 2025, owing to their extensive use as stable anchorage components in fixed orthodontic treatment. Molar bands are placed around posterior teeth and provide strong support for archwires, buccal tubes, and other orthodontic attachments. They are particularly important in cases involving bite correction, tooth movement, and arch expansion. Their ability to withstand orthodontic forces makes them widely preferred by orthodontists over smaller bands. Increasing use of fixed braces among children, adolescents, and adults is further supporting demand for molar bands.

The premolar bands segment is projected to witness the fastest growth at a CAGR of 6.5% during the forecast period, driven by increasing use of fixed orthodontic appliances for comprehensive tooth alignment and anchorage applications. Premolar bands can provide additional anchorage when treatment requires controlled movement of multiple teeth. Their use is particularly relevant in cases involving crowding, spacing, and complex tooth-position corrections. Growing adoption of customized orthodontic treatment is also encouraging the use of appropriately sized bands for individual tooth anatomy. Increasing orthodontic treatment among adults is creating additional demand for treatment components that can support customized treatment plans. Improvements in band design and availability of multiple sizes are further improving clinical usability.

  • By Material

On the basis of material, the orthodontic bands market is segmented into stainless steel, ceramic, titanium, composite resin, and others. The stainless steel segment dominated the market with a 73.97% share in 2025, owing to its high strength, durability, corrosion resistance, and cost-effectiveness. Stainless steel bands can withstand the mechanical forces generated during fixed orthodontic treatment and provide reliable long-term performance. Their established clinical use and broad availability make them the preferred material across dental and orthodontic practices. Stainless steel is also comparatively economical, making orthodontic treatment more accessible in price-sensitive markets. Manufacturers have continued improving stainless-steel band designs through anatomical contouring and enhanced retention characteristics.

The ceramic segment is projected to register the fastest growth at CAGR of 7.0% during the forecast period, driven by increasing patient preference for aesthetically discreet orthodontic appliances. Ceramic materials offer a tooth-colored or less conspicuous appearance compared with conventional metallic components, making them particularly attractive to adult patients and young professionals. Growing awareness of dental aesthetics is encouraging patients to seek orthodontic solutions that minimize the visual impact of treatment. Advances in ceramic materials are also improving their strength, durability, and clinical performance. The broader orthodontics market is witnessing increasing adoption of aesthetic materials as patients become more willing to seek less visible treatment options.

  • By Design

On the basis of design, the orthodontic bands market is segmented into seamless bands, welded bands, bands with hooks, and bands without hooks. The seamless bands segment dominated the market with a share of 45% in 2025, owing to their uniform construction, durability, and reduced risk of structural weakness at welded joints. Seamless designs provide consistent mechanical performance and are suitable for orthodontic procedures requiring reliable posterior anchorage. Their smooth construction can also support improved patient comfort and reduce areas where plaque and debris may accumulate. Orthodontists widely use these bands in routine fixed-appliance treatments because of their predictable fit and strength. Increasing emphasis on durable orthodontic components is further supporting demand for seamless designs.

The bands with hooks segment is projected to witness the fastest growth at a CAGR of 6.8% during the forecast period, driven by increasing demand for orthodontic bands that provide additional attachment points for elastics and other treatment components. Hooks can simplify clinical procedures by allowing orthodontists to connect elastics directly to the band. This design is particularly useful in treatments involving bite correction, tooth movement, and anchorage management. Increasing demand for treatment customization is encouraging orthodontists to select bands with integrated attachment features. Manufacturers are also developing anatomically contoured bands with pre-welded or integrated attachments to improve clinical efficiency. These developments can reduce chairside preparation and facilitate more predictable appliance placement.

  • By Application

On the basis of application, the orthodontic bands market is segmented into malocclusion correction, teeth alignment, bite correction, arch expansion, and other orthodontic applications. The malocclusion correction segment dominated the market with a share of 40% in 2025, owing to the widespread use of orthodontic bands as part of fixed appliances for correcting improperly positioned teeth and jaws. Malocclusion represents a major indication for orthodontic treatment and includes conditions such as crowding, spacing, overbite, underbite, and crossbite. Molar bands provide stable anchorage that enables orthodontists to apply controlled forces during correction. Increasing awareness of the functional and aesthetic consequences of untreated malocclusion is encouraging more patients to seek orthodontic treatment. Rising orthodontic treatment volumes among children, adolescents, and adults are consequently supporting demand for bands used in malocclusion correction.

The arch expansion segment is projected to register the fastest growth at a CAGR of 7.0% during the forecast period, driven by increasing use of orthodontic appliances designed to widen dental arches and create additional space for tooth alignment. Orthodontic bands provide stable anchorage for expanders and other appliances used during arch-development procedures. Growing diagnosis of transverse discrepancies and dental crowding is increasing the need for controlled arch expansion in appropriate patients. Advances in orthodontic treatment planning are also enabling clinicians to develop more customized expansion approaches based on individual anatomical requirements. Increasing adoption of early orthodontic intervention among children is further supporting demand for appliances used in arch expansion.

Which Region Holds the Largest Share of the Orthodontic Bands Market?

  • North America dominated the orthodontic bands market with the largest revenue share of 35.96% in 2025, supported by advanced orthodontic infrastructure, high dental care spending, and widespread adoption of fixed orthodontic treatments
  • The region also benefits from strong adoption of orthodontic treatments, high patient awareness, and the presence of established orthodontic manufacturers and suppliers. Increasing demand for aesthetic and technologically advanced orthodontic solutions, along with the widespread availability of specialized dental services, continues to strengthen North America’s leadership position in the global market.

U.S. Orthodontic Bands Market Insight

The U.S. orthodontic bands market is witnessing strong growth due to rising demand for orthodontic treatments, advanced dental care infrastructure, and increasing adoption of fixed orthodontic appliances. The country’s mature dental care ecosystem, along with the presence of established orthodontic manufacturers, specialized clinics, and advanced distribution networks, is driving demand for orthodontic bands. In addition, growing awareness regarding oral health, increasing prevalence of malocclusion, and greater access to orthodontic services are accelerating the adoption of orthodontic bands across dental clinics and orthodontic practices.

Asia-Pacific Orthodontic Bands Market Insight

The Asia-Pacific orthodontic bands market is expected to witness rapid growth, driven by increasing demand for orthodontic treatments, expanding dental care infrastructure, and rising awareness of oral health across countries such as China, India, and Japan. Growing access to specialized dental services, increasing adoption of fixed orthodontic appliances, and demand for affordable orthodontic solutions are supporting regional market expansion. In addition, the growing number of dental clinics, improving healthcare infrastructure, and increasing availability of advanced orthodontic technologies are accelerating orthodontic bands adoption across the region.

Japan Orthodontic Bands Market Insight

The Japan orthodontic bands market is witnessing consistent growth due to rising demand for orthodontic treatments, advanced dental care services, and increasing focus on oral health. Dental clinics and orthodontic practitioners are increasingly adopting high-quality orthodontic bands for fixed orthodontic procedures and complex tooth alignment treatments. Moreover, growing awareness regarding dental aesthetics, increasing availability of specialized orthodontic services, and the adoption of advanced and biocompatible orthodontic materials are further contributing to market growth.

China Orthodontic Bands Market Insight

The China orthodontic bands market is growing rapidly, driven by increasing demand for orthodontic treatments, expanding dental infrastructure, and rising awareness regarding dental aesthetics and oral health. Growing adoption of fixed orthodontic appliances across dental clinics, along with increasing availability of advanced and cost-effective orthodontic products, is significantly boosting market demand. In addition, rising investments in dental healthcare, increasing access to orthodontic services, and the growing number of patients seeking malocclusion correction are positioning China as one of the fastest-growing markets for orthodontic bands globally.

U.K. Orthodontic Bands Market Insight

The U.K. orthodontic bands market is experiencing steady growth, supported by rising demand for orthodontic treatment, well-established dental care infrastructure, and increasing adoption of advanced orthodontic products. Growing availability of specialized orthodontic services and increasing demand for reliable and durable fixed orthodontic appliances are contributing to market growth. Furthermore, greater awareness of dental aesthetics, improvements in orthodontic treatment technologies, and increasing use of advanced and customized orthodontic solutions are strengthening the U.K. market for orthodontic bands.

Germany Orthodontic Bands Market Insight

The Germany orthodontic bands market is expanding steadily due to the country’s strong dental care infrastructure, advanced healthcare capabilities, and increasing demand for orthodontic treatments. Dental clinics and orthodontic specialists are increasingly utilizing orthodontic bands for tooth alignment, malocclusion correction, and other fixed orthodontic procedures. Continuous advancements in orthodontic materials, growing adoption of biocompatible and precision-fit products, along with strong emphasis on high-quality dental care and oral health, are further driving market growth in Germany.

What are Latest Developments in Orthodontic Bands Market?

  • In June 2025, researchers published a study in BMC Oral Health evaluating the cytotoxicity and genotoxicity of orthodontic bands after aging. The study examined stainless-steel orthodontic bands subjected to simulated aging and assessed their potential biological effects. The findings provide additional evidence on the long-term biocompatibility and safety of orthodontic bands and highlight the importance of material stability and biological performance in orthodontic applications.
  • In July 2023, researchers published a prospective cohort study evaluating orthodontic brackets, molar bands, and other orthodontic auxiliaries used during orthognathic surgery. The study reviewed the types and frequency of these components and assessed their risk of failure during surgical procedures. The research provides clinically relevant evidence on the continued use and performance of molar bands as part of fixed orthodontic appliances, supporting the importance of reliable band design and secure attachment.
  • In May 2022, researchers published a study in the Journal of Oral Biology and Craniofacial Research comparing three light-cured orthodontic band cements Resilience, Band-it, and Transbond Plus for microleakage at the enamel-cement and band-cement interfaces. The study evaluated different curing-light intensities and examined the performance of the materials around orthodontic bands. The findings contribute to the development and selection of improved bonding materials for more reliable orthodontic band placement.
  • In December 2022, researchers published an ex-vivo study investigating modified resin-reinforced glass-ionomer cement containing ultrasound-activated nanoparticles for use around orthodontic bands. The research evaluated the material's physical-mechanical and anti-biofilm properties against Streptococcus mutans. The study found that selected nanosonosensitizers improved the antimicrobial properties of the orthodontic cement without compromising fluoride release, highlighting potential advances in materials used to secure orthodontic bands and reduce bacterial accumulation.
  • In September 2021, researchers published an in-vitro study in International Orthodontics examining the immediate cytotoxic effects of resterilized stainless-steel orthodontic molar bands. The researchers evaluated bands subjected to different numbers of sterilization cycles and measured their effects on human gingival fibroblast cells. The study found no significant difference in optical density among the different sterilization groups, providing useful evidence regarding the biological safety of orthodontic bands following repeated sterilization.
